Default Canyon Lake (TX.) & Upper Guadalupe River

CANYON LAKE: Water gin clear; 84 degrees; 909.80':

Largemouth are fair to good at first light in 8'-15' on redbug/chart plastic stickbaits like Tiki Sticks or Senkos, white 7/16 oz. Terminator tungsten spinnerbaits (www.terminatorlures.com). Ledges and open
water humps in 20'-30' are holding suspended fish during the day. Carolina rigging a pumpkin/chartreuse Snap Back lizard or chartreuse Craw Tubes (www.cremelure.com) will get their attention. Upriver,
bass are good to 6 lbs. using a 3/8 oz. white/blue/chart Terminator spinnerbait, pitching watermelon/red Snap Back creature Baits and 1/4 oz. blue/blk Rattlin' Jigs w/#11 Uncle Josh Pork trailers (www.unclejosh.com).

Smallmouth are good to 3 lbs on smoke/red Snap Back tubes and Smokin' Green Devil's Tongues (www.cremelure.com) on drop shot rigs and white plastic stickbaits like Senkos or Tiki Sticks, wtrmelon/grn
or gold flake Cut Tail worms or rootbeer/ grn curl tail grubs. Both rigged on 1/8 oz. jigheads.

Striped Bass are very slow in 60'-80' vertically jigging 1 oz. Pirk Minnows. White Bass are slow.

Crappie are fair upriver on Curb's crappie jigs and minnows.
